
"The move aims to combine SpaceX's prowess in launches with xAI's expanding vision in artificial intelligence, as Musk has detailed the need for space-based data centers that will require massive amounts of energy to operate. It has always been in the plans to bring Musk's companies together under one umbrella. "My companies are, surprisingly in some ways, trending toward convergence," Musk said in November. With SpaceX and xAI moving together, many are questioning when Tesla will be next. Analysts believe it is a no-brainer."
"Dan Ives of Wedbush wrote in a note earlier this week that there is a "growing chance" Tesla could be merged in some form with the new conglomeration over the next 12 to 18 months. "In our view, there is a growing chance that Tesla will eventually be merged in some form into SpaceX/xAI over time. The viewis this growing AI ecosystem will focus on Space and Earth together... and Musk will look to combine forces," Ives said."
SpaceX acquired xAI to integrate rocket launch capabilities and satellite infrastructure with advanced AI model development. The combined entity aims to support space-based data centers that require massive energy and could be powered by orbital or solar-optimized systems. Analysts foresee a potential Tesla merger within 12–18 months, forming a "Musk Trinity" that combines Tesla's physical AI (Robotaxi, Optimus, Full Self-Driving), SpaceX's Starlink and orbital compute, and xAI's models such as Grok. The synergy could accelerate global autonomy, satellite-enabled operations, and large-scale AI training. The FCC has invited comments on SpaceX's Orbital Data Centers application.
